More eyeshadow tips & tricks
Applying eyeshadow can be tricky. There are so many colours and types: powders, creams, sticks... You can apply it in many Man ways, and there are plenty of tips and tricks to help. Here’s everything summarised for you:
- Choose a colour that suits you – Start by using a colour that complements your eye tint. You can choose from hundreds of colours. Above we explained some shades that suit your eye colour well.
- Eyeshadow primer – Use an eyeshadow primer. It helps blend eyeshadow more easily, keeps it longer, fades less, and colours come out beautifully!
- Build up your eyeshadow – For bright or dark shades, it’s best to build up the colour gradually. Better to apply one shade several times than to load your brush with a lot of powder at once. This Man method lets you blend well after each step and see when you’ve applied enough eyeshadow.
- Blend eyeshadow well – This is a must to create a nice transition. You want to avoid harsh lines. Blending with different brushes helps achieve a smooth finish.

Eyebrow hacks for flawless eyebrows
- Don’t overpluck your eyebrows – To get Perfecte eyebrows, it’s important not to remove too many hairs. Overplucking can make your eyebrow shape look unnatural. To avoid this, here’s a great tip: brush your hairs upwards with an eyebrow brush before plucking and remove only hairs sticking out at the lower edge. This way, you won’t remove the good hairs.
- Use two shades when filling in your brows – To make your eyebrows look longer, use two powder shades. For the inner part of your brow, choose a lighter colour, slightly lighter than your hair colour. For the middle and tail, use a shade matching your hair colour.
- Promote eyebrow growth – To make your brows fleek even more, help them grow beautifully. Use castor oil to stimulate growth by boosting blood circulation. Our tip is the Nanobrow Eyebrow Serum.
- Use an eyebrow gel – For the best results, an eyebrow gel is ideal. It shapes your brows nicely and keeps them neat all day long!
- Apply a highlighter – Add a bit of shine to complete your brow look. Applying highlighter just above your brow arch makes it look higher. You can also apply some below your brows to sharpen the lines. The highlight brings more attention to your eyes. This way, your brows really fleek!

Tip 1: Consider your hair colour
Your hair colour also plays a role in picking the best lip colour. Find your hair colour below with a matching lip shade.
- Blonde hair → Try nude shades or light pink and brown tones.
- Brown hair → Try dark red, pink-beige, or dark pink colours.
- Black hair → Bordeaux creates a beautiful effect, also brown tones, fuchSia, and raspberry red.
- Red hair → Copper and bronze shades, or even orange or red with brown undertones suit you beautifully.
Tip 2: How to determine your skin’s undertone?
Here are tips to discover your skin’s undertone. This is important as it helps you find the best lip colour and also assists in choosing other make-up products.
- See which Si jewellery suits you better. If gold Si jewellery brightens your face and silver makes you look dull, you have a warm undertone. If silver jewellery suits you better, then your undertone is cool.
- Look at the colour of the veins on your wrists. If they appear blue, you likely have a cool undertone. If green or olive, you have a warm undertone. If you’re unsure, you might have a neutral undertone.

Tip 1: Dust powder onto your lashes
After your first coat of mascara, dust your lashes with loose powder – this adds volume by making lashes look thicker. Add a second coat of mascara to cover the powder, and voilà!
Tip 2: Use eyeshadow as Eyeliner

Tip 4: Clean your sponge in 1 minute
Fill a bowl with warm water, add a drop of washing-up liquid and soak your sponge. Place the bowl in the microwave for 1 minute and rinse the sponge once the water has cooled. Ready-to-use again! Check out the sponge below you can use;)
